Agreeable to an Order of the Worshipful Court of York County date October 16th 1798 We the Subscribers being first sworn have appraised in current Money on the 16th Novr. 1798 the Personal Estate of James Gemmill decd as follows To Wit

one sorrel Mare£10..0..0
1 ditto £18 1 ditto £15 1 Mare Colt £639..0..0
1 Yoke of oxen £11 1 ditto £10 ditto £1031..0..0
1 old Stear £5 2 young ditto £712..0..0
2 Brindle Cows £7 2 Red ditto £714..0..0
2 Red Cows £8 2 ditto £7 1 ditto £318..0..0
2 Red heifers £6 1 brindle ditto £3..107..10..0
2 small ditto £4 1 ditto £26..0..0
2 Cow yearlings £3 4 bull ditto £47..0..0
10 the first choice of hogs £1010..0..0
1 ditto 2d choice 7/6.. 7..6
12 Shoats more or Less £3..123..12..0
2 Breeding Sows £2..2..1 Barrow not up £13..2..0
1 Bed sheet and Bolster £44..0..0
1 old bedstead 9/ 1 bed sheets blanket Rag & Beding 7..9..0
1 Bed sheets Rug and bolster £5..1 pine safe 5/5..5..0
1 meat barrel Tray and Sifter 3/.. 3..0
1 old pine chest Knife Box &c parcel of old Knives & forks.. 9..0
1 old case 1/6 1 pine Table 4/6 6 flag Chairs 12/..18..0
1 Frying pan & grid Iron 10/ 1 dutch oven 3/..13..0
1 Pot rack &c 10/ 1 gun and flat Irons 20/1..10..0
1 Rum but 3/ 2 ox chains £11..3..0
1 set of bar wheel Boxes 7/6 5 hoes 7/6 2 axes & 1 hatchet 4/6..19..6
1 saw drawing knife & 2/ 6 two wheels 12/..14..6
2 Tubs 1 pigon 2/6 1 chest & 2 barrels &c 4/6.. 7..0
2 dishes of Plates 5 Basons & 6 Spoons £1 1 Razor1..1..6
2 Queen China dishes & 6 Plates 6/ 5 Bowles 7/6..13..6
1 Fat Tub 1/6 1 Grind Stone 3/ 1 large Pot 15/..19..6
1 Small Iron Pot 4/6 1 half Bushell & 2 Pigans 3/.. 7..6
1 Stear yoke and Barrell 3/ 1 old Iron Pot 4d... 3..4
£190..7..10

William S. Wills
James Kerby
Peter Holloway

Returned into York County Court the 17th day of December 1798 and ordered to be recorded
Teste
Ro: H Waller CYC
